Job Purpose

The role of a Health Care Assistant is helping our residents to live full, happy, and healthy lives by delivering person-centred care, meaningful activities, support, and companionship. It’s a fun, rewarding, and fulfilling role where no day is the same and you’ll build genuine relationships and make a real difference each day — helping residents enjoy life and receive the quality care and opportunities they deserve.

Job Responsibilities

  • Support residents with personal care, maintaining their privacy, dignity, and respect at all times.
  • Engage residents in meaningful conversations and activities that enhance their quality of life.
  • Deliver care in a person-centred manner, tailored to individual needs and preferences.
  • Conduct regular wellbeing and health checks in accordance with individual care plans.
  • Collaborate effectively with colleagues and external healthcare professionals to ensure consistent, high-quality care.
  • Accurately record and maintain resident information using digital documentation systems.
  • Promptly report any incidents, changes, or concerns to senior team members.
